What Is a Rate Comparison Tool?
A fraction of a percentage point on a mortgage is worth thousands of dollars over 30 years. This tool compares two rates on the same loan amount and term, showing the monthly difference, the lifetime interest difference and the total savings.
All figures come from the amortization formula with your inputs — the tool makes the trade-off visible so you can judge whether a lower rate justifies its costs (points, fees).
The Method
Each rate is amortised independently over the same term; the tool reports the per-month and lifetime differences.

Frequently Asked Questions
How much does 0.5% save on a mortgage?
On a $300k, 30-year loan, a 0.5% rate cut saves roughly $90–100 per month and $30,000+ in interest over the term.
Should I pay points for a lower rate?
Compare the upfront cost with the monthly savings — the break-even point tells you when the lower rate pays for itself.
Is the difference the same every year?
No — the interest portion falls over time, but the monthly payment difference stays constant for fixed-rate loans.
Does this include fees?
No — it compares pure rates. Add fees to see the true cost of each option.
What if the terms differ?
The tool compares equal terms. For different terms, compare the total costs instead.
